               However, we find nothing disclosed or suggested by any of              
          the references relative to the claimed feature of associating the           
          bookmarks by creating an affinity link “responsive to the                   
          affinity exceeding a predetermined threshold.”  The examiner                
          relies on pages 6-7 of Maarek for this suggestion.  However, we             
          have read and re-read the Maarek reference, concentrating on the            
          cited portions thereof, and we are at a loss to find any clear              
          suggestion of this claim limitation.  The examiner appears to               
          rely on the disclosure, at page 7, of expressing a minimum degree           
          of intra-cluster similarity as a “percentage” as a finding that             
          the reference discloses an affinity “threshold.”
